Event #110 Short Non-captures
Type: Move length modifier.
Condition: Can not be started with another move length modifier event.
Moves that does not capture can only travel a maximum of 2 squares. Castling is unaffected by this event.
Note: The knight travels a distance of 2 squares, so the knight is unaffected by this event.
Example 1:
Since non-capturing moves can only be a maximum of 2 squares, moves like Ba6, Bb5, Bc4, Qg4 or Qh5 are not legal.
Example 2:
Captures can be done at any distance. White plays 1.Rxd8#. A check is a threat of capturing the enemy king, so checks are not restricted. Blacks bishop can only move a maximum of 2 squares and can not reach f8. Black is checkmated.
Example 3:
Castling is unaffected by this event, so white can play 0-0-0, despite the rook moving 3 squares. White can not play 0-0 since blacks rook is threatening the f1 square.
